commit 374cc9624abe4af886b159a2a0beefdc27cbac40
Author: Michael Meissner <meissner@linux.ibm.com>
Date: Fri Apr 12 19:05:11 2024 -0400
Add support for -mtar
2024-04-12 Michael Meissner <meissner@linux.ibm.com>
gcc/
* config/rs6000/constraints.md (h constraint): Add tar register to
documentation.
(wt constraint): New constraint.
* config/rs6000/rs6000-cpus.def (ISA_2_7_MASKS_SERVER): Add -mtar.
(POWERPC_MASKS): Likewise.
* config/rs6000/rs6000.cc (rs6000_reg_names): Add new tar register.
(alt_reg_names): Likewise.
(rs6000_debug_reg_global): Likewise.
(rs6000_init_hard_regno_mode_ok): Likewise.
(rs6000_option_override_internal): Likewise.
(rs6000_conditional_register_usage): Likewise.
(print_operand): Likewise.
(rs6000_debugger_regno): Likewise.
(rs6000_opt_masks): Likewise.
* config/rs6000/rs6000.h (F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ER): Likewise.
(FiXED_REGISTERS): Likewise.
(CALL_REALLY_USED_REGISTERS): Likewise.
(REG_ALLOC_ORDER): Likewise.
(reg_class): Add new TAR_REGS register class.
(REG_CLASS_NAMES): Likewise.
(REG_CLASS_CONTENTS): Likewise.
(r6000_reg_class_enum): Add RS6000_CONSTRAINT_wt.
(REG_NAMES): Add tar register.
* config/rs6000/rs6000.md (TAR_REGNO): New constant.
(movcc_<mode>): Add support for tar register.
(movsf_hardfloat): Likewise.
(movsf_hardfloat): Likewise.
(mov<mode>_softfloat): Likewise.
(mov<mode>_hardfloat64): Likewise.
(mov<mode>_softfloat6): Likewise.
(indirect_jump): Likewise.
(@indirect_jump<mode>_nospec): Likewise.
(@tablejump<mode>_absolute): Likewise.
(@tablejump<mode>_insn_nospec): Likewise.
(<bd>_<mode>): Likewise.
(<bd>tf_<mode>): Likewise.
* config/rs6000/rs6000.opt (-mtar): New option.
* doc/invoke.texi (RS/6000 options): Document -mtar.
